
ArcherMind company in cooperation with Chinese hardware manufacturers revealed the world’s first car navigation systems based on Android. Designed for cars with the lower end of the device was fitted in a 7-inch display with a resolution of 800 x 480. Also you can browse the web via WiFi or 3G, connect with music players and phones over Bluetooth and even play back audio files stored on the HDD or SD slot, we can’t imagine it being a tough sell.
The system is already being tested by one of China’s car manufacturers.
